Wall Street CEO’s death, Nevada politics mix

The death of a Wall Street investment bank chief executive isn't typically the type of news that would intersect with Nevada politics.

But the death of Bruce Wasserstein of Lazard Ltd. is a special case.

Lazard is the firm that employs John Chachas, a Republican campaigning against Sen. Harry Reid, D-Nev.

Here's Chachas' statement on the Wasserstein news: "Nothing has changed in my exploration of a run for the US Senate. Bruce was an immensely talented CEO. But Lazard will persevere and prosper thanks to the leadership by him and others. He will be sorely missed and our prayers are with his family."
